CAYA Coven's Festival of Bliss & Bleassings
CAYA COVEN INVITES YOU TO THE FESTIVAL OF BLISS & BLESSINGS
HOSTED BY THE EKSTASIS GILD
DIVINE EMBODIMENT
If it were not for us and our bodies as temples, such ecstasies of Life & Living, the Divine would never know.
This year CAYA Coven's Festival of Bliss & Blessings, hosted by the Ekstasis Gild, will be offered as a ritual of dance movement and trance meditation. Our ritual tool for this night will be the Body Temple - the sacred vessel which holds our precious divinity and our tenuous connection to the Divine. Join us as we celebrate the Body Temple through presence, music, and dance. In gratitude, we give honor to Dionysus, God of fruitful epiphanies and liberation through music and dance. Those who partake of his mysteries are empowered by the God himself. His gift returns us to our natural embodied state and self-authentic presence.
The space & ritual will also accommodate those with limited mobility, different abilities, limited endurance, etc; so all may be fully present and participate without having to dance or even dance continually. At this ritual one may choose to offer one's Self through sacred dance movement or contemplative stillness in ever-present trance.
Water and refreshing beverages will be provided during the ritual.
All are invited to bring an instrument to play and join in the musical offering.
There will also be opportunities for "gift exchanges." Those most interested in participating in the trance activity of the ritual are invited to "be present" as an anchor for a dancer. Dancers are invited to offer to dance the Ekstasis for someone holding sacred presence. In this way, the exchange facilitates connectedness between participants of the various ritual activities and highlights our sacred interconnectedness to one another.
There will be socializing and cakes and ale afterwards.
